Report Overview

The global uterine manipulation devices market size was valued at USD 245.76 million in 2020 and is expected to exp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.6% from 2021 to 2028. The rising prevalence of diseases related to female reproductive organs, increase in the adoption of minimally invasive or noninvasive procedures, and technological advancements are among the major factors driving the market. The market has been adversely impacted by the pandemic. The COVID-19 pandemic is affecting significant aspects of various companies, such as product demand, operations, supply chain, distribution systems, and the ability to research and develop new products. Almost all the companies are affected by reduced procedure volume due to COVID-19 as all hospital resources are being diverted to combat the disease.

Nowadays, minimally invasive and noninvasive surgeries are gaining popularity owing to the reduced risk associated with these procedures. Smaller incisions decrease postoperative pain and facilitate speedy recovery, leading to the high adoption of these procedures. For instance, laparoscopic or robotic-assisted hysterectomy is a less invasive surgical technique performed to remove the uterus. A small incision is made in the lower abdomen and a miniature camera and small, specialized instruments are inserted and used for the removal process. Thus, the risk of blood loss and infection is lower in the case of minimally invasive procedures than open surgeries. Thus, an increase in patient preference for noninvasive or minimally invasive treatment and benefits offered by these techniques are expected to boost the market growth at a significant rate during the forecast period.

Application Insights

In 2020, the total laparoscopic hysterectomy (TLH) segment dominated the market with a revenue share of 38.88%. TLH is performed for treating conditions such as fibroids, pelvic pain, painful or heavy menstrual periods, pre-cancer or cancer in the uterus, endometriosis or adenomyosis, or prolapse. It is an in-patient procedure and is usually performed under general anesthetic and patients spend only a night in the hospital. It involves 2-4 weeks of recovery at home. Moreover, the recovery period associated with major abdominal hysterectomy is longer in comparison with laparoscopic surgery, which is leading to an increase in the preference for laparoscopic surgery. Thus, the segment is expected to witness rapid growth over the forecast period.

The laparoscopic supracervical hysterectomy (LSH) segment is expected to expand at the highest CAGR during the forecast period. A laparoscopic supracervical hysterectomy (LSH) is also a minimally invasive procedure, which involves removing a uterus and leaving the cervix in place. It is performed to treat conditions or complications of the uterus such as endometriosis, fibroids, abnormal vaginal bleeding, pelvic pain, and infection in ovaries/fallopian tubes. LSH is a partial hysterectomy that removes only the diseased uterus and preserves the cervix, and often ovaries, thus resulting in less pain, fewer adhesions, less technical difficulty, and quicker recovery than open surgery. This is supporting the segment growth.

End-use Insights

In 2020, the hospitals segment dominated the market with a share of 59.15%. The growth of this segment can mainly be attributed to an increase in the number of patients suffering from various gynecological conditions and a consequent rise in the number of surgical procedures. Hospitals offer superior care to patients and provide reimbursements for certain procedures, which is further contributing to the segment growth. Furthermore, hospitals are currently advancing in terms of technology. Technologically advanced devices are being used extensively in hospitals to provide better treatment. These devices are not only simplifying treatment procedures but also providing better, faster, and accurate results.

The ambulatory surgery centers segment is expected to expand at the highest CAGR during the forecast period. High preference for outpatient surgeries, increase in the adoption of minimally invasive surgeries, and cost-effectiveness of ambulatory surgery center-based laparoscopic procedures are among the key factors responsible for the lucrative growth of this segment. The lower risk of post-surgical complications in minimally invasive laparoscopic surgery is expected to increase the demand for ambulatory surgery centers. They offer several advantages to patients including shorter procedure time and same-day discharge as compared to hospitals. Most intra-abdominal procedures can now be performed laparoscopically at ambulatory surgery centers as these are less invasive. Surgeries at ambulatory surgery centers not only have shorter stay duration but are also more affordable than inpatient procedures, which reduces patient expenditure. Thus, owing to the abovementioned factors, the ambulatory surgery centers segment is likely to witness rapid growth during the forecast period.

Regional Insights

North America dominated the market with a share of 35.67% in 2020 and is expected to witness considerable growth over the forecast period. This is owing to the increasing number of gynecology-related surgical procedures/hospital visits, the presence of well-established healthcare infrastructure, favorable reimbursement policies, and supportive regulatory reforms in the healthcare sector. According to CMS, healthcare spending in the U.S. increased by 4.6% and reached USD 3.8 trillion in 2019, accounting for approximately 17.7% of GDP. The national health spending is expected to grow at an annual rate of 5.4% from 2019 to 2028, to reach USD 6.2 trillion by the year 2028. The ease of access to healthcare technologies and the presence of strong distribution channels are also driving the adoption of uterine manipulation devices in the region.

The Asia Pacific market is anticipated to exhibit lucrative growth during the forecast period. The presence of a large patient pool and the growing need for technologically advanced and cost-effective healthcare solutions are among the factors expected to present significant growth opportunities for the market. Moreover, an increase in the number of clinical trials and high R&D investments by global market players to enter untapped markets in the Asia Pacific region owing to low-cost services are high-impact rendering drivers of the market. In addition, an increase in the number of hospitalizations and rapid advancements in the clinical development framework of developing economies are aiding market growth in this region.
